Output 8d291d15eaa54766885fe1a14608268f170c109add66a33e071dfbd55ce63914:0

value
37872
script pubkey
OP_0 OP_PUSHBYTES_20 bc03a3622a433247a977e8e18aa92768f9e7bb11
address
bc1qhsp6xc32gvey02tharsc42f8dru70wc397qsa3
transaction
8d291d15eaa54766885fe1a14608268f170c109add66a33e071dfbd55ce63914
spent
true